#b88498 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b88498 is composed of 72.2% red, 51.8%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.3% magenta, 17.4%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 336.9 degrees, a saturation of 26.8% and a lightness of 62%. #b88498 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#710931.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#b88498 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b88498 has RGB values of R:184, G:132,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.17,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12092568.

Shades and Tints of #b88498
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f9f4f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b88498
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a29a9d is the less saturated color, while #fb4189 is the most saturated one.
